Changes since 1.32: +2 -4 lines
o bridging the gap between eddy stress and GM.
  -> eddyTau is replaced with eddyPsi (eddyTau = f x rho0 x eddyPsi)
      along with a change in CPP option (now ALLOW_EDDYPSI).
  -> when using GM w/ GM_AdvForm:
      The total eddy streamfunction (Psi = eddyPsi + K x Slope)
      is applied either in the tracer Eq. or in momentum Eq.
      depending on data.gmredi (intro. GM_InMomAsStress).
  -> ALLOW_EDDYPSI_CONTROL for estimation purpose.
  The key modifications are in model/src/taueddy_external_forcing.F
  pkg/gmredi/gmredi_calc_*F pkg/gmredi/gmredi_*transport.F
